Manager, Solutions Engineering

238k – 322kSan Francisco, CAEngineering ManagementHybrid3+ YOE
Summary

Leads a team of Solutions Engineers providing technical expertise to sales for driving ARR in a B2B SaaS analytics company. Requires 3+ years people management in pre-sales/technical consulting and deep data/analytics knowledge.

About the role

Responsibilities

  • Develop & Mentor: Lead, coach, and grow a high-performing and inclusive team of Solutions Engineers, actively investing in their career development and upholding a high standard of performance.
  • Drive Results: Partner closely with Sales leadership and Account Executives to provide technical expertise that drives new, retained, and expansion ARR. Ensure your team's activities are directly contributing to the company's bottom line.
  • Prioritize & Problem Solve: Guide your team through complex customer evaluations and technical challenges. Manage team resources effectively, aligning the right skills to customer needs to achieve productivity targets and successful outcomes.
  • Cross-Functional Partnership: Act as a key technical liaison, collaborating with peer managers across Sales, Product, and Engineering. Gather and synthesize customer feedback from your team to influence product strategy and solve problems at scale.
  • Communicate & Manage Change: Effectively translate broader company and departmental strategy into clear, actionable goals for your team. Guide your direct reports through evolving business priorities with empathy and clarity.
  • Hire the Best: Actively assess the needs of the team, build a pipeline of top talent, and hire outstanding individuals who elevate the team's capabilities and contribute to our inclusive culture.
  • Innovate & Raise the Bar: Relentlessly seek to improve how your team operates, from refining demo strategies and proof-of-concept methodologies to adopting new tools and processes that increase effectiveness and celebrate success.

Requirements

  • Progressive experience in a B2B SaaS environment, including 3+ years of people management experience leading a technical pre-sales, solutions engineering, or professional services team.
  • "Player-coach" mentality with deep knowledge in the data and analytics space. Expert on how data products (like CDPs, data warehouses, and analytics tools) are implemented and adopted by customers.
  • Proven cross-functional partner with a track record of successfully working with sales teams to navigate complex deals and drive revenue.
  • Expertise in communicating complex technical concepts clearly and effectively to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Skilled at prioritizing team activities and managing workload in a dynamic environment, balancing customer needs with efficiency goals.
  • Natural mentor and developer of talent, with a passion for coaching and a history of building inclusive, high-achieving teams.
  • Handles ambiguity with ease, demonstrating flexibility and a proactive, problem-solving mindset when adapting to new challenges and business priorities.
  • Actively seeks feedback and is humble to learn, consistently looking for ways to improve themselves and their team.

Nice-to-Haves

  • Previous experience in management consulting, strategic operations, or a similar role focused on go-to-market strategy.
  • Direct, hands-on experience with Mixpanel or other product analytics tools like Amplitude, Pendo, or Contentsquare.
  • Strong familiarity with the modern data stack, including tools like Snowflake, Google BigQuery, Segment, or Hightouch.

Compensation

  • Total target cash compensation (TTCC): $238,300—$321,705 USD (includes base and variable compensation).
  • Eligible for equity consideration and benefits including medical, vision, dental insurance, 401(K), wellness benefit.
